Abstract
A 29-year-old man was admitted to the hospital for examination of an incidentally found retroperitoneal tumor. The solid tumor was 2.0 cm in diameter and the tumor margin was clear. Abdominal Doppler US showed that the tumor was rich in vascularity, and the tumor content was partially enhanced by gradient-CT. The possibility of malignancy was not ruled out and then the tumor was removed. The tumor was in contact with the IVC and right renal vein and connected to a white bundle seemed like nerves. Histologically, the tumor was benign Schwannoma.<br>Schwannoma shows a variety of appearances on imaging such as US, CT or MRI according to the hisitological degenerative degree. In the case of a small retroperitoneal tumor, it is not easy to obtain biopsy samples for diagnosis due to several huge vessels and organs adjacent to the tumor. We report a case of a retroperitoneal benign Schwannoma that was not diagnosed preoperatively.
